Output 82c15b267fafa7f6c9540d88888bba50e89611503f67ee542f5a9d301c376743:0

value
18655693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da859bf8784fab51f37b9dceb72362a55ddc4d36 OP_EQUAL
address
MTpbbang1kT2qwdF2CLLf5bBiz1uhzcJ1w
transaction
82c15b267fafa7f6c9540d88888bba50e89611503f67ee542f5a9d301c376743
spent
true